What reviewers said

Campfire Audio Bonneville

The Campfire Audio Bonneville is a premium hybrid in-ear monitor that pairs a 10mm dynamic driver with three balanced armatures to deliver a warm, musical signature with strong bass presence and expansive staging. It offers a comfortable fit and easy power requirements, making it a versatile high-end choice for listeners prioritizing enjoyment over strict neutrality, though its isolation is slightly below par for the category.

  • Pro:Warm, engaging tuning with impactful bass
  • Pro:Comfortable and lightweight fit for long sessions
  • Pro:Easy to drive thanks to low impedance
  • Con:Isolation is weaker than some competing hybrids
  • Con:Tuning favors musicality over neutrality
  • Con:High price point may limit accessibility

Westone W80 V3

The Westone W80 V3 is a premium universal in-ear monitor packing eight balanced armature drivers into a compact shell, delivering a refined, well-balanced sound with impressive detail retrieval. Its low impedance and high sensitivity make it easy to drive from most sources, while the detachable cable adds flexibility for customization or replacement. This model is aimed at discerning listeners who want a versatile, professional-grade tuning for critical listening or stage use.

  • Pro:Exceptional clarity and micro-detail across the frequency range
  • Pro:Neutral, well-balanced signature suitable for many genres
  • Pro:Very efficient, works well with portable devices
  • Con:High price point may not suit budget-conscious buyers
  • Con:Low impedance can be sensitive to source output impedance
  • Con:Housing may feel less premium than some competitors at this price
